Position Summary
The Bartender is responsible for properly preparing and serving al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ages to casino guests. Must verify that all guests requesting alcoholic beverages are of legal age by checking proper identification at all times. The Bartender will be required at all times to follow proper policies and procedures for serving alcoholic drinks in accordance with all state and federal regulations pertaining to the distribution of alcohol (ABLE) laws. The Bartender must possess exceptional customer service skills and professional demeanor towards both guests and co-workers.
